Pregnant horse falls into ditch
A horse bearing a foal has been rescued after falling into a ditch and trapping itself in Beaworthy, Devon. The horse was 9 months pregnant, which created a problem for the fire department who had to act quickly as the horse had already been trapped for 3 hours. It took two fire crews and a specialist team to free the horse from the ditch, a digger was used to remove part of the 8ft deep bank where ropes where then used to pull the horse to safety.
A vet then checked the horse over reporting that both the foal and its mother were fine and the birth would go ahead as planned next month.
Mr Jenkins, who owns the horse has praised all those involved in the rescue: "They were absolutely brilliant it was a real team effort".
